Decision Summary
The appeal was rejected because governing regulations, specifically 8 C.F.R. ยง 214.1(c)(5), state there is no appeal from the denial of an application for extension of stay filed on Form I-539. The AAO therefore concluded it had no jurisdiction to review the case.

Robe iemann, Chief Administrative Appeals Office WAC 05 027 50744 Page 2 DISCUSSION: The Director, California Service Center, denied the application to extend a period of stay in nonirnmigrant status. The matter is now before the Administrative Appeals Office on appeal. The appeal will be rejected. The petitioner seeks to extend her period of stay as a nonimmigrant dependent of an intracompany transferee pursuant to $ 10 1 (a)(15)(L) of the Immigration and Nationality Act, 8 U.S.C. 1 101 (a)(15)(L). The director denied the applicant's request for extension of nonimmigrant status after the nonimmigrant petition of the applicant's father was denied. The applicant, through counsel, filed an appeal of the director's decision. It is noted that 8 C.F.R. 214.1(~)(5) states that there is no appeal from the denial of an application for extension of stay filed on Form 1-539. The applicant's appeal must be rejected. ORDER: The appeal is rejected.
